Operating Temperature: -40 to +70°C (-40 to +158°F).
Sensitivity Adjustment:  Easily accessible, located on top of the sensor 
head beneath a watertight gasketed screw-cover.  15-turn clutched control; 
rotate clockwise to increase sensitivity.
Alignment Indicator: Red LED on top of sensor head. Banner's ex-
clusive AID™ circuit (*US patent no. 4356393) lights the LED whenever 
the sensor sees its own modulated light source, and pulses the LED at a 
rate proportional to the strength of the received light signal.
False Pulse Suppression on Power-up:  100ms delay on  power-
up.

Banner MAXI-BEAM
® 
sensors are highly versatile, self-contained, modular-
ized photoelectric sensing controls that are ideally suited to industrial en-vi-
ronments.  The basic MAXI-BEAM is an ON/OFF switch consisting of three 
modules (sensor head, power block, and wiring base)  and a unique, patented, 
rotatable "programming ring" that enables you to program your choice of 
"light" or "dark" operate mode, sensing range, and response time.
MAXI-BEAM sensor heads have an easily-accessible multi-turn SENSI-
TIVITY  control  for  precise  adjustment  of  system  gain.  Interchangeable 
sensor  heads  are  rotatable  in  90-degree  increments  and  are  available  in 
retroreective,  diffuse,  opposed,  convergent,  xed-eld  proximity,  and 
beroptic sensing modes. Each sensor head also includes Banner's exclusive, 
patented  AID™ circuit (Alignment Indicating Device*), which features 
an LED alignment indicator that lights whenever the sensor "sees" its own 
modulated light source, and pulses at a rate proportional to the strength of 
the received light signal. 
A wide selection of MAXI-BEAM power  block  modules  is available to 
interface the sensor head to the circuit to be controlled.   The plug-in design 
of the wiring base enables easy exchange of the entire sensing electronics 
without disturbing eld wiring.
Optional customer-installable logic modules easily convert the basic ON/OFF 
MAXI-BEAM into either a one-shot or delay logic function control, with 
several programmable timing ranges for each function. 
MAXI-BEAM  sensors  are  ruggedly  constructed  of  molded  VALOX
® 
to 
NEMA standards  1,  3, 4,  12,  and 13,  and  have  interchangeable molded 
acrylic lenses.  Modules simply snap and bolt together, with no interwir-
ing necessary.  Module interfaces are o-ring and quad-ring sealed for the 
ultimate in dust, dirt, and moisture resistance.
